How To Make Chicken Mac and Cheese Bake

Preheating the oven. - 3
  1.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 200°C (390°F) to get it ready while you prepare the pasta and sauce.
Cooking the macaroni pasta in a large pot of salted water. - 4
  1. Cook the Pasta: Boil macaroni in a large pot of salted water until tender. Drain well, then transfer to a deep baking dish and set aside.
Sautéing the onion and carrot. - 5
  1. Sauté the Vegetables: In a large skillet, cook the onion and carrot until the onion turns translucent. This builds a flavorful base for your creamy sauce.
Stirred in the chicken, broccoli, and mushrooms. - 6
  1. Add the Chicken and Broccoli: Stir in the chicken, broccoli, red bell pepper and mushrooms, cooking until the chicken is browned and the broccoli just begins to soften.
Added the garlic, cream, stock powder, and salt in the pan. - 7
  1. Make the Sauce: Add garlic, cream, stock powder, and salt. Once the cream begins to simmer, remove from heat and stir in half of the Parmesan. Pour this over the pasta and coat evenly.
Close-up shot of Creamy Chicken Mac And Cheese Bake. - 8
  1. Grill Until Golden: Switch the oven to grill or broil on medium heat. Sprinkle the remaining Parmesan over the top, then place the dish under the grill until golden and bubbly. Serve hot and enjoy!

Tips For Making Chicken Mac And Cheese Bake

  • For the best Chicken Mac and Cheese Bake, make sure your pasta is slightly undercooked before baking. It’ll continue cooking in the sauce and come out perfectly tender, not mushy.
  • If you prefer a thicker, creamier sauce, let it simmer for a minute longer before combining it with the pasta. The sauce will thicken as it bakes, so don’t worry if it looks a little runny at first.
  • Want extra flavor? Use a mix of Parmesan and mozzarella, or even a touch of cheddar for that gooey pull. And for a crispy topping, sprinkle a handful of breadcrumbs over the cheese before grilling.
  • Leftovers can be reheated in the oven or microwave — just add a splash of milk or cream to bring back that creamy texture.

Yes, it freezes beautifully. Let it cool completely, cover tightly, and freeze for up to 2 months. Reheat in the oven until warmed through.

Macaroni is the classic choice, but penne, shells, or rigatoni also hold the creamy sauce perfectly in this baked chicken mac and cheese.

Parmesan gives a sharp, salty bite and golden color, but you can mix in mozzarella or cheddar for extra melt and stretch.

Creamy Chicken and Mushroom Macaroni Cheese Bake

Ingredients

  • 16 oz packet macaroni pasta
  • 1 medium brown onion chopped
  • 1 large carrot washed, peeled and chopped
  • 1/2 large red capsicum/bell pepper washed, seeded and diced
  • 1 lbs boneless skinless chicken thigh fillets, cubed
  • 1 head of broccoli washed and cut into florets
  • 7 oz sliced mushrooms washed
  • 2 cloves garlic minced or finely chopped
  • 2 cups light cooking cream I used 2x tubs Philadelphia Extra Light cream for cooking
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able stock powder I use Vegeta
  • 2 pinches salt to season
  • 3/4 cup parmesan cheese grated and divided

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 200℃ | 390℉.
  • Cook pasta in a large saucepan of salted, boiling water, following packet directions until tender. Drain pasta in a colander and pour into a deep baking dish . Set aside.
  • While pasta is boiling, pan fry in a large and deep frying pan/skillet , onion and carrot until onion is transparent. Add the chicken, broccoli and mushrooms, and cook until chicken has browned and broccoli has softened slightly. Stir through garlic, cooking cream, stock powder and salt (adjust to your tastes). When cream begins to simmer, remove from heat and stir through 1/2 cup parmesan cheese. Pour Creamy Chicken onto pasta and stir through really well to combine.
  • Change oven setting to grill/broil on medium heat. Sprinkle pasta and chicken mixture with remaining cheese, and place into oven to brown on top.
  • When golden on top, remove from oven and serve!

How to Make The Quickest Tacos

I know weeknights are crazy! You want an amazing Taco Tuesday, but you need it FAST. These are my secret weapons for getting delicious tacos on the table in under 30 minutes.

  • Prep Ahead: Chop your lettuce, tomatoes, and onions in the morning or the night before. Store them in airtight containers in the fridge. When it’s time to eat, you just have to set them out!
  • Use Smart Shortcuts: Don’t be afraid to use pre-shredded cheese, a bag of slaw mix, or a good quality store-bought pico de gallo or guacamole to save time. You can find pico de gallo in the refrigerated section, I love the one from Trader Joe’s . It’s known for being consistently fresh, chunky, and having a great flavor. My biggest tip for any store-bought pico is to drain off any extra liquid at the bottom of the container and give it a stir. If you want to make it taste homemade, add a quick squeeze of fresh lime juice and a little chopped cilantro. It makes all the difference!
  • Cook The Meat in Batches: I love to cook a double batch of taco meat on Sunday. I use half for dinner that night and save the other half for Tuesday. It reheats in minutes and its good to store in an airtight container in the fridge for 3 to 4 days.

What to stuff in a Perfect Taco?

Building the perfect taco is an art, and it’s all about the layers! Here’s my guide to the essential components.

  • The Tortilla: Choose your base! Flour tortillas are soft and pliable, great for over-stuffed tacos these are my personal favourite, I use the Tortilla Land uncooked flour tortillas. You find them in the refrigerated section and cook them in a hot pan for about 30 seconds per side. They puff up and taste incredible. Corn tortillas offer an authentic, slightly sweet flavor and are amazing when quickly charred on a gas stove or in a hot pan. Hard Shells give you that classic, satisfying crunch.
  • The Protein: While the recipes below give you tons of options, don’t be afraid to mix it up! Pick from seasoned ground beef, shredded chicken, spicy chorizo, or black beans for a great veggie option.
  • The Toppings (The Best Part!): Get creative with a taco bar! Set out bowls of lettuce, tomatoes, onions, cilantro, jalapeños, cheese, sour cream, salsa, and guacamole!
